Leading Protein Powders for Muscle Growth
Whether you're to build muscle or simply enhance your protein intake, choosing the right powder can make a huge difference. Check out some of the top-rated options available:
* **Whey Protein:** This time-tested choice is rapidly absorbed by the body and rich in essential amino acids.
* **Casein Protein:** A slow-digesting protein that's great for nighttime consumption or between meals.
* **Plant-Based Protein:** Soy, pea, rice, and hemp are popular choices for vegetarians, vegans, and those with dairy intolerances.
No matter your dietary needs or fitness goals, there's a protein powder out there to help you achieve your targets.

Effective Protein
The effectiveness of protein supplements hinges on several scientific factors. Firstly, the type of protein used plays a crucial role. Whey protein, derived from milk, is quickly digested by the body, making it ideal post-workout for muscle repair. Casein protein, also from milk, digests more slowly and provides a sustained release of amino acids, suitable for nighttime ingestion. Plant-based proteins like soy or pea protein offer choices for individuals with lactose intolerance or following vegetarian/vegan diets.
Another key factor is the protein's percentage. Opting for supplements with a higher protein concentration ensures you're getting the maximum benefit per serving. Additionally, interpreting your individual needs and fitness goals is paramount. Consult a healthcare professional or registered dietitian to determine the right protein intake for you and select supplements that align with your dietary requirements.

Nourishment Options for Plant-Based Eaters
Embracing a vegan or vegetarian lifestyle doesn't mean sacrificing ample protein. A wide array of delicious and nutritious options are available to ensure you meet your necessary intake. Legumes, like beans, are a versatile source of protein, packing fiber and other essential vitamins. Tofu, made from soybeans, is another excellent option, taking on the seasonings of whatever dish it's in. Nuts like almonds, chia seeds, and pumpkin seeds are also rich with protein and healthy fats. Don't forget about quinoa, a complete protein that can be used in bowls, or edamame, steamed soybeans that make a tasty snack. By incorporating these vegan protein sources into your diet, you can flourish on a plant-powered approach to food.
Supercharge Your Recovery with Optimal Protein
Protein is an essential nutrient for muscle growth and repair, making it crucial for optimal recovery after exercise. Digest the right amount of protein can speed up your body's ability to rebuild and restore damaged tissues. Aim for around 30 grams of protein within one hours after your workout to maximize muscle protein synthesis. Include high-quality protein sources like lean meats, poultry, fish, eggs, dairy products, and plant-based options such as legumes, tofu, and quinoa into your diet to aid your recovery process and attain your fitness goals.
